From 1a883af91567fd86b966d6fb4d7d33c1110067db Mon Sep 17 00:00:00 2001 From: László Németh Date: Mon, 31 Mar 2014 11:12:57 +0200 Subject: fdo#75109 librelogo: fix localized procedures Change-Id: Ia6edb02b871a41828758ba5fd5376c811c4084cc --- librelogo/source/LibreLogo/LibreLogo.py |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/librelogo/source/LibreLogo/LibreLogo.py b/librelogo/source/LibreLogo/LibreLogo.py index 7b5930bf715b..d44ffa194a6d 100644 --- a/librelogo/source/LibreLogo/LibreLogo.py +++ b/librelogo/source/LibreLogo/LibreLogo.py @@ -1607,11 +1607,16 @@ def __compil__(s): if len(subnames) > 0: globs = "global %s" % ", ".join(subnames) # search user functions (function calls with two or more arguments need explicite Python parentheses) + ends = __l12n__(_.lng)["END"] # support multiple names of "END" + firstend = ends.split("|")[0] + s = re.sub(r"(? 0: -- cgit v1.2.3